When a technician repairs the IMEI of a Samsung phone or removes a network lock using professional service tools (like Z3X Box, Octopus Box, or Chimera), the phone's security certificate becomes altered. If you perform a factory reset or update the device software after this process, the network patch breaks, leading to a complete loss of cellular signal.
